Output 3573576f5457450d2454385969d62c0aee2dbd8ad159c2a99587eedb3373f46d:0

value
524700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f048cd7c230ded865374cc579e670d99cc522606 OP_EQUAL
address
3PbXK13iQ5JEr4VjadyGGeBpLBs2i6cEAJ
transaction
3573576f5457450d2454385969d62c0aee2dbd8ad159c2a99587eedb3373f46d
confirmations
438544
spent
true